How to Repair a Cracked Composite Door

Even though black composite door scratch repair doors are extremely durable, they may still develop cracks due to wear and tear. Fortunately cracks caused by these are usually easily repaired.

Replacement-Doors-300x200.jpgAll you need is the plastic filler, a uPVC friendly cleaning agent (HG uPVC Powerful Cleaner is a great choice) and a few medium to fine-grit sandpaper. It is essential to first clean the crack.

Identifying the Crack

Composite doors are a popular option for front doors due to their durability and style. Like any other door that is made of wood, composite doors can face issues with time. The majority of these issues can be resolved without calling in professionals.

If you hear a loud cracking sound every when you shut or open your door made of composite it could mean that the frame is damaged. This is especially relevant if the crack is visible along the edges of the frame. In this situation it could be that the frame and door were not properly installed initially. You should consult the professional who installed your composite door to fix this problem.

The misalignment of latches and hinges is another issue that can be found in composite doors. This is often the result of excessive use or wear and tear, however, it could be caused by fluctuations in temperature and humidity. Fortunately, this is another issue that is usually fixed by adjusting the screws.

It is also possible that the frame of your composite door isn't big enough. This can happen if the frame was not properly installed by an experienced professional installer. If the frame is too small, it will not be capable of supporting the weight of the door. This can lead to cracking or warping, as well as creaking.

Another potential cause of a crack in a composite door could be weather damage. The most frequent form of weather damage to composite doors is a worn out or missing weather seal. This could allow cold air to enter your home, as well as debris and rain. A broken or damaged weather seal can easily be fixed by replacing it with a brand new one specifically designed for composite doors.

Regular cleaning is the most essential component of maintaining the composite door panel replacement front door. This will keep the surface from being damaged or scratched. it can help prevent any stains from forming. It is recommended to clean your composite door replacement parts door with soapy water every week at a minimum to avoid the pitting of your hardware. You should also grease hinges every year.

Cleaning the Crack

composite door scratch repair doors are popular with home owners because of their long-lasting durability and low maintenance feel. However, they can experience various common issues over time including cracks and warping. Fortunately, a majority of these issues can be fixed without the need for professional intervention.

A composite door is constructed from a solid timber core to give the strength and stability needed and uPVC to weatherproof it against the elements. The exterior skin is made of glass reinforced plastic (GRP) and comes in a variety of styles and finishes, such as woodgrain or a smooth contemporary finish. Composite doors are created by combining different materials that make them extremely durable and resistant to moisture and resistant to scratches.

The best way to ensure your composite door stays looking good is to keep it clean and dry. Regular cleaning with a mild cleaner and a cloth should suffice to keep it looking great, but you should also wipe it down after rainfall or prolonged exposure to sunlight. Avoid using abrasive cleaners as they can damage the surface. Always make sure to use clean water after you've finished.

Another simple method to keep your composite door looking nice is to grease the hinges and locks on a regular basis. A lubricant specifically specially designed specifically for uPVC doors and locks is ideal, but be careful not to overdo it because too much grease could cause the lock to become stuck or not work at all.

Check the weather stripping of your composite door to ensure it's in good condition and working properly. This will help reduce drafts, and will save you on your heating bills.

Modern composite doors are extremely durable and resistant to most common problems. However, they can be damaged by abrupt temperature fluctuations or wear and tear. Fortunately, it is not usually required to hire a professional to fix these problems or even cracks that are large can be repaired using some plastic filler and some sandpaper.

Filling in the Crack

Composite doors are strong but are susceptible to cracking due to physical damage, like scratches or impacts. They may also break because of changes in humidity or temperature. Cracks that are caused by these factors can be easily repaired with an easy DIY technique.

In the beginning, you'll be required to determine the source of the crack. It could be as easy as crackling noise that you hear when you shut or open the door. However, it could be more significant such as visible cracks or damage to the external glass panel. If the issue is more severe it is recommended to consult a professional for help.

The next step is to apply a filler over the crack. Plastic fillers are available that are specifically designed to be used on uPVC or composite materials. They will typically be composed of liquid and powder that has to be mixed and composite door crack repair applied immediately, as they set quickly. Make use of a putty knife to apply the filler, and make sure you get it all the way to the other side.

After the filler has been applied after the filler has been applied, you'll have to sand the surface to create smoothness. To do this, you can employ an electric sander, or a light sanding tool. After you've sanded your area, you will need to apply a clear coat of polyurethane or varnish to protect the filler and your door.

If the sound of door hinges is making you hear cracking sounds You should grease the hinges in order to stop them from slipping or becoming stiff over time. This will ensure the integrity of the hinges as well as help to extend their life.

You can keep your composite door looking as new by regularly sanding it, using a touch-up pen for repair of any scratches, and then applying the same color to ensure an even appearance. Regularly lubricating any moving parts will also ensure they work smoothly and enhance the longevity of your composite door. This is an easy step that is often forgotten, but it can make a huge difference to your door's performance and appearance.

Sanding the Crack

A composite door is strong and robust, but it's also immune to the odd creak or crack. It is likely that you will experience these issues with the frame, which can occur due to many reasons, such as wear and tear. If you're worried that your composite doors are beginning to show signs of aging There are a few simple steps you can take to rectify the problem.

You should first clean the crack and surrounding area. This will help to prevent dirt from getting intermingled with the repair work you will be doing later. Use a uPVC-friendly, fragrance-free cleaning agent, like HG uPVC Powerful Cleaner available on Amazon to clean any accumulated dirt and grit. Dry the area completely before moving on.

After the crack has been cleaned after which you can begin the Composite door crack Repair (Historydb.date). You can select between putty and filler for this step based on whether your door is painted or not. If your door is painted, select the wood filler that will be sanded once it has set. Once you've applied your preferred filler, let it set. Sanding the compound down will help smooth the surface and make it appear more natural.

You'll also need to consider the size of the crack before you start sanding. A larger crack will require more than filler or putty to fix. If your door is showing indications of this, then you may have to insert a wood spline into the split to provide a long-lasting solution.

The best way to stop a split from forming is to ensure the door frame and hinges are properly positioned. It is also crucial to lubricate all moving parts, including hinges, using an oil designed specifically for uPVC or composite materials.
